Abstract

The invention discloses a physical and cardiac strength identification system, which comprises a body-building device, a cardiac electrical sensing device, an identification processing device and a display device. The body-building device is provided with a power module and generates operation data through user operation, wherein the operation data comprises an output voltage and an output current. The electrocardiograph sensing device senses the heart state of the user to generate electrocardiograph sensing data. The identification processing device receives the operation data and the electrocardio sensing data to identify and process the operation data and the electrocardio sensing data so as to generate physical strength information and cardiac strength information. The display equipment is connected with the identification processing device to display the physical strength information and the heart strength information.

Refer to Fig. 1, it is the block chart of physical ability of the present invention and heart intensity identification system.This physical ability and heart intensity identification system 100 mainly comprise body-building device 1, electrocardio sensing apparatus 2, signal acquisition apparatus 3, identification blood processor 4 and display device 5, signal acquisition apparatus 3 connects body-building device 1, electrocardio sensing apparatus 2 and identification blood processor 4, and identification blood processor 4 also connects display device 5.Wherein, electrocardio sensing apparatus 2, signal acquisition apparatus 3, identification blood processor 4 and display device 5 all can be installed in body-building device 1, to be integrated with an equipment, and such as treadmill, weight training machine, stepping machine etc., but not as limit.Body-building device 1 includes a power module 11, and to provide the power supply needed for described body-building device 1, if electrocardio sensing apparatus 2 is connected to body-building device 1, then power module 11 also can be powered to electrocardio sensing apparatus 2; If when electrocardio sensing apparatus 2 is an autonomous device, then electrocardio sensing apparatus 2 contains a battery module, preferably rechargeable battery.
In above-mentioned, signal acquisition apparatus 3 can comprise USB-6009DAQ data acquisition card and Modbus communication interface, USB-6009DAQ data acquisition card is in order to capture the signal of body-building device 1 and electrocardio sensing apparatus 2, and Modbus communication interface is in order to reach identification blood processor 4 by captured signal.Identification blood processor 4 includes a storage module 41, and storage module 41 stores multiple physical ability intensity comparison value and multiple heart intensity comparison value, and this identification blood processor 4 can open up identification system for one, utilizes " can open up theory " to perform data identification process.Display device 5 includes a communication module 51, this display device 5 contains laboratory virtual instrument engineering platform (LaboratoryVirtualInstrumentationEngineeringWorkbench, LabVIEW), namely described communication module 51 can be the telecommunications functions comprised in LabVIEW, and described display device 5 can be connected to an external device (ED) 200 via communication module 51 telecommunication.This external device (ED) 200 can be mobile phone, tablet PC or notebook computer etc., but not as limit.
In above-mentioned, body-building device 1 produces an operational data through a user operation, this operational data can comprise an output voltage and an output current, further include body-building device 1 rotating speed in use, and comprise the calorie consumption amount calculated according to described output voltage and described output current through described body-building device 1.Wherein, the computing of described calorie consumption amount, calculates an output according to output voltage and output current, then calculates an energy with output, then go out calorie consumption amount by energy balane.The heart state of electrocardio sensing apparatus 2 sensing user, to produce wholeheartedly electric sense data.Signal acquisition apparatus 3 in order to capture out by body-building device 1 and produced the respectively operational data of electrocardio sensing apparatus 2 and electrocardio sense data, and can transfer to identification blood processor 4.Identification blood processor 4 receives operational data and electrocardio sense data, to carry out identification process to operational data and electrocardio sense data, to produce a physical ability strength information and a heart strength information.Display device 5 shows physical ability strength information and heart strength information, and can pass through communication module 51 physical ability strength information and heart strength information are reached external device (ED) 200.Wherein, operational data and each physical ability intensity level compare to produce corresponding physical ability strength information by identification blood processor 4, and are compared to produce corresponding heart strength information with each heart intensity comparison value by electrocardio sense data.

Physical ability of the present invention and heart intensity identification system mainly through electrocardio sensor and fitness equipment of arranging in pairs or groups to diagnose health physical ability signal and heart intensity, by signal acquisition card USB6009DAQ card and the correlated characteristic measured when communication module Modbus extract user moves, such as heartbeat signal, heart rate variability degree and trample data (such as generating voltage, generation current, consume calorie, trample revolution speed) etc., the gap of physical ability difference and heart intensity before and after motion can be measured, and user's physical ability and heart intensity are with or without normal condition and temper grade to utilize this identification system to judge.
This physical ability and heart intensity identification system are arranged in pairs or groups Self-power-generation body-building device and electrocardio sensor, and coordinate USB6009DAQ card, Modbus data acquisition card be integrated into specifically can with heart intensity diagnostic fitness equipment.As seen in figures 2 and 3, user is trampled motion at utilization tool power-generating body-building apparatus and is carried out electrocardio sensing simultaneously, utilize analogy-digital capture card, as USB6009DAQ, the data acquisition cards such as Modbus or DCON, before sense movement with after physical ability and the Data Data (electrocardiosignal) of heart rate variability degree, such as heart rate (HR), extremely low frequency rate variance (DVLF), altofrequency (HF), the interval standard deviation (SDNN) of R-R, coefficient of variation value difference (DCV) etc., physical ability and heart intensity is diagnosed out to differentiate by identification system can be opened up, such as palmic rate state, generating variable quantity, return rotation speed change, heart rate variability degree changes.Wherein physical ability differentiate to be divided into comfortablely to trample, sportsing body-building, cardiopulmonary contest and aerobic win victory, the differentiation of heart intensity can be divided into not tired, more tired and very tired, virtual instrument software is used to be presented in every communication interface, such as mobile phone, computer etc. data and display state.Thus, get final product the difference of physical ability before and after the motion of identification user, and improve physical condition through this judgement, also recognition software can be located at the monitoring station of gymnasium in addition through communication system, and as the various data that consumer notes down when instantly moving, in order to the foundation of going to gymnasium to temper physical ability backward.
This identification system design concept mainly understands kinesiology and fitness equipment electricity generating principle, find out from correlation technique people do not move before static health, and the situation after vigorous exercise, the mode recycling capture card afterwards captures the matter-element of fitness equipment and electrocardio sensor correlated characteristic, finally utilize and can open up theory to calculate numerical value, and judge generic by program.Its utilization can be opened up identification method research and development and a set ofly be had health diagnosis system, its identification step comprise obtain heart beating and body builder power generation system also have some physiological situations, set up the matter-element of default feature, calculate can open up distance, set weighted value and compute associations function, use to facilitate in the future.The present invention can according to the matter-element can opening up theory and must first set up user physical condition, and in the more described physical condition to be measured of tranmittance and data base, the degree of association size of physical condition is diagnosed.
Enhancing body resistance device utilizes DC generator to generate electricity, and utilizes the characteristic principle of electromotor, will obtain output voltage and output current, and calculate generated output power, then uses power to calculate energy, finally converts the energy into the calorie consumed when driving.
Electrocardio sensing is then some numerical value utilizing some raw medical technologies arts to obtain to measure human body when moving, and looks for taking-up feature by these data, in order to find out these character numerical values, designs an easy electrocardio sensor.And electrocardio sensor principle mainly comes from heart.When cardiac muscle is in activity, namely Weak current will be produced when heartbeat, utilize electrode input, instrument amplifier, high low-pass filter amplifier, post-amplifier, analogy-digital capture card, detect the frequency of heart beating, and judge heartbeat by this mode and present waveform, its flow process can be as shown in Figure 4.The generation current that electrocardio sensor can utilize fitness equipment to trample, voltage supply, also can take from 9 volts of aneroid battery.And after through physical ability that identification system produces can be opened up and heartbeat data can present in graphical form via LabVIEW virtual instrument monitoring software, and every data can be transmitted in via LabVIEW the mobile phone or computer etc. that user uses, user can be grasped constantly and understands oneself physical ability and heart state.
